Cerfacs Entrez dans le monde de la haute performance...

Introduction au HPC pour les décideurs (PME) – Version bêta

Le calcul haute performance (HPC) regroupe les moyens de calcul de puissance très élevée capables de résoudre des problèmes extrêmement complexes. Il est au cœur de l'innovation et des avancées majeures. Ce cours présente le contexte théorique nécessaire pour aborder ces enjeux.

Prochaine session

Du lundi 17 mars 2025 au dimanche 13 avril 2025

Date limite d’inscription : 15 jours avant la date de début de chaque formation

Limitation à 45 participants !

Avant de vous inscrire, merci de nous signaler toutes contraintes particulières dont vous souhaiteriez nous faire part (horaires, santé, indisponibilité…) à l’adresse e-mail suivante : training@cerfacs.fr

Descriptif

L'utilisation du calcul haute performance est devenu une question centrale pour résoudre les problèmes de demain. Il s'étend à divers secteurs comme la santé, la transition écologique, l’évolution du climat, jusqu’aux risques financier et constitue une ressource stratégique pour l'avenir de l'Europe. L'accès aux aides et aux ressources HPC de l'Union Européennes à disposition des PME requiert un minimum de connaissances.

Programme

Cette formation en ligne présente les concepts fondamentaux du calcul haute performance. Le contenu du cours est divisé en 4 semaines consécutives :

Semaine 1 : Introduction au HPC

  • Définition et application du calcul intensif
  • Les moyens de calcul disponibles en France et en Europe
  • Le coût du calcul intensif pour une PME européenne
  • Initiatives nationales et européennes pour aider les PME dans le domaine du calcul intensif

Semaine 2 : Architecture des supercalculateurs

  • Introduction au hardware des supercalculateurs
  • Classement des supercalculateurs
  • Programmation parallèle
  • Introduction au calcul GPU
  • Indicateurs du compilateur : Bases et optimisation

Semaine 3 : Techniques de programmation parallèles

  • Les bases de la ligne de commande en Unix
  • Configuration de l’environnement logiciel
  • Soumission de travaux sur un supercalculateur
  • Benchmarking
  • Système de gestion des versions du code

Semaine 4 : Introduction à l’IA dans un contexte HPC

  • IA et HPC : des domaines étroitement liés
  • Introduction à l’intelligence artificielle avec Scikit-learn
  • Introduction à l’exploration de données avec Pandas et Seaborn
  • Introduction pratique à Scikit-learn
  • Optimiser les résultats avec Scikit-learn

VOIR LE TEASER DE FORMATION

Objectifs pédagogiques

A l'issue de cette formation, vous serez capable :

  • D'expliquer les enjeux du HPC.
  • D'identifier l'utilité du HPC pour un projet de recherche ou industriel.
  • De donner des recommandations pour bénéficier des capacités du HPC.

Organisation de la formation

Il s'agit d'une session de formation entièrement en ligne. Elle est divisée en 4 semaines consécutives, sur la base d'activités d'apprentissage dispensées chaque semaine.

  • Les semaines 1 à 4 nécessitent environ 2 heures de travail par semaine. Les activités d'apprentissage sont diffusées le lundi de chaque semaine et vous disposez de 7 jours pour effectuer les activités de chaque semaine. Les deux heures de travail peuvent être réparties sur la semaine, en fonction de votre emploi du temps.
  • Trois sessions interactives en direct auront lieux les semaines 1, 3 et 4. 
  • Des contrôles continus permettront de déboucher sur un certificat d'apprentissage.

Nos principes pédagogiques

Toutes nos sessions de formation reposent sur des principes issus de la psychologie cognitive et de la recherche sur l'apprentissage :

  • les concepts d'abord : le cours est axé sur la compréhension conceptuelle de leur application dans des cas pratiques (Van Heuvelen, 1991).
  • apprentissage collaboratif : le cours est organisé autour d'activités spécialement conçues pour faire interagir les participants entre eux, impliquant un traitement en profondeur du contenu scientifique préalablement montré dans de courtes vidéos (Salmon, 2013).
  • rétention à long terme : parce que dans l'avenir vous devez appliquer dans divers contextes ce que vous apprendrez au cours de cette session, nos cours sont conçus en utilisant les 10 principes testés en laboratoire sur la psychologie cognitive (Halpern et Hakel, 2003).

Soyez prêt à vous engager et à interagir avec une communauté partageant un objectif commun : l'apprentissage du contenu scientifique de ce cours.

Modalités pédagogiques

La formation est une alternance de présentations théoriques. Des questions à choix multiples permettent une évaluation continue.

Pré-requis

Bien que ce cours ne s'adresse pas à des informaticiens et experts en informatique, vous devez avoir quelques notions en informatique en algorithme. Par ailleurs, la maitrise orale et écrite de l’anglais est indispensable pour suivre cette formation. 

Pour vérifier que les conditions préalables sont remplies, vous devez répondre aux questionnaires suivants : https://forms.gle/Tj9SFiYcemnHjkc56 Vous devez obtenir au moins 75 % de réponses correctes afin d'être autorisé à suivre cette formation. 

Pour vous inscrire, CLIQUER ICI !

Tarifs

Cette formation, financée dans le cadre du projet européen EuroCC2, est gratuite mais réservée aux salariés des entreprises membres de l'Union Européenne. Elle est normalement au prix catalogue de 480 € HT.  Néanmoins, votre inscription est conditionnée au versement d'une caution de 200 Euros. Cette somme vous sera restituée en fin de formation si votre participation a bien été effective. Sinon, elle sera conservée en compensation du préjudice causé en laissant inutilement des personnes sur liste d'attente.

Evaluation des acquis

Un examen continu sera effectué pendant la formation.

Formateurs référents

Laure BOURGOIS, Ingénieure-formatrice spécialisée en IA, INRIA

Benoist GASTON, Ingénieur HPC, CRIANN

Joeffrey LEGAUX, Ingénieur de recherche, CERFACS

Jean-Christophe JOUHAUD, Senior Researcher, CERFACS

L'AGENDA

Mardi

04

Mars

2025

🎓Soutenance de thèse Francis MEZIAT

Mardi 4 mars 2025 à 14h00

  Salle JCA, Cerfacs, Toulouse    

Lundi

10

Mars

2025

Introduction aux pratiques de programmation pour le calcul scientifique

Lundi 10 mars 2025 à 14h00

  Formation    

Jeudi

13

Mars

2025

🎓Soutenance de thèse Mehdi CIZERON

Jeudi 13 mars 2025 à 14h00

  Salle JCA, Cerfacs, Toulouse    

CONSULTER L'AGENDA